Monterrey (MTY) to San Diego (SAN) Flight Distance
The flight distance from General Mariano Escobedo International Airport (MTY) in Monterrey, Mexico to San Diego International Airport (SAN) in San Diego, United States is 1,825 kilometers (1,134 miles / 986 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 3h, flying west northwest at a heading of 299°.
